Medicare Part D Prescriber Enrollment

Any physician or other eligible professional who prescribes Part D drugs must either enroll in the Medicare program or opt out in order to prescribe drugs to their patients with Part D prescription drug benefit plans. Researchers investigate how early life trauma contributes to functional neurological disorder

In individuals with functional neurological disorder, the brain generally appears structurally normal on clinical MRI scans but functions incorrectly (akin to a computer software crashing), resulting in patients experiencing symptoms including limb weakness, tremor, gait abnormalities and non-epileptic seizures.

American Heart Association partners in global effort to prepare for UN non-communicable diseases summit

The American Heart Association is participating in an international effort to prepare for a United Nations (UN) high-level summit next year on non-communicable diseases (NCDs). These diseases — mainly cardiovascular illnesses including stroke, diabetes, cancer and chronic respiratory conditions — were estimated to cause more than 60 percent of deaths worldwide in 2005.
